WHO WE ARE

PUR Projet is a global leader in supply chain sustainability. We develop socio-environmental projects within the supply chains of our Corporate Partners. Through the economic and social empowerment of local communities and the introduction of sustainable development initiatives at the agricultural level, PUR Projet seeks to address climate change, while regenerating and preserving the ecosystems upon which these supply chains depend. PUR Projet’s projects consist in insetting, regenerative agriculture, agroforestry, forest conservation and landscape restoration. PUR Projet is a B Corp company which employs over 150 people with a presence in 15 countries.
